Foundation Stabilizing Services

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ques and solutions designed to address issues related to a building’s foundation stability. These services typically include the installation of various underpinning methods, such as piers, piles, or anchors, to reinforce and stabilize the foundation structure. The goal is to prevent further movement, mitigate existing damage, and restore the integrity of the property’s foundation, ensuring it remains secure and level over time.

These services help resolve common problems associated with foundation movement, including cracking walls, uneven floors, and misaligned doors or windows. Foundation instability can result from soil settlement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. By stabilizing the foundation, property owners can reduce the risk of structural damage, improve safety, and maintain the value of their property. Addressing foundation issues early with professional stabilization can also prevent more costly repairs in the future.

Properties that typically utilize fo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ially those in areas prone to soil movement or with expansive clay soils. Commercial buildings, multi-family residences, and even some institutional facilities may also require stabilization work when foundation settlement or shifting threatens structural integrity. These services are applicable across various property types where foundation health is a concern, providing a vital solution to maintain the stability and safety of the structure.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Melrose Park,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ical costs for foundation stabilization services can range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, a small repair in Melrose Park might cost around $3,500, while larger projects could reach $9,500 or more.

Factors Affecting Cost - Expenses vary based on the foundation type, soil conditions, and the size of the affected area. Minor stabilization might cost under $4,000, whereas extensive underpinning could exceed $15,000 in some cases.

Material and Method Costs - The choice of materials, such as polyurethane injections or steel piers, influences the price. Material costs generally range from $1,500 to $5,000, with labor and equipment adding to the overall expense.

Project Complexity - More complex stabilization projects involving multiple foundation points or difficult access can significantly increase costs. Typical service costs are often between $4,000 and $12,000, but complex cases may be higher.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ation stabilizing? Foundation stabilizing involves techniques to reinforce and support a building’s foundation to prevent or repair settling and shifting issues.

How do professionals stabilize a foundation? Experts typically use methods such as underpinning, piers, or epoxy injections to improve foundation stability based on the specific condition.

What signs indicate foundation instability?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around moldings may suggest foundation issues.

Is foundation stabilizing a permanent solution? When performed by experienced service providers, stabilization methods aim to provide long-term support and mitigate further movement.
